FRUIT SALAD WITH VODKA RECIPE | EAT SMARTER USA
The Fruit Salad with Vodka recipe out of our category Fruit Salad! EatSmarter has over 80,000 healthy & delicious recipes online. Try them out!
Total Time 10 minutes
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Peel the mango, cut the flesh from the core and cut into wedges. Rinse the limes and cut into wedges. Cut the papaya with the seeds into thin columns.
- Peel the kiwis and cut into wedges. Fill the fruit into 4 glasses. Drizzle each glass with 1 tablespoon of lime juice and some vodka. Serve chilled.
BOOZY FRUIT SALAD RECIPE | ALLRECIPES
A great fruit salad with a bit of a boozy twist. Great for summer cookouts! Best served the same day as preparation.
Provided by Valerie Regulski
Categories Salad Fruit Salad Recipes Strawberry Salad Recipes
Total Time 15 minutes
Prep Time 15 minutes
Yield 1 salad
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Combine watermelon, strawberries, bananas, and mandarin slices in a large bowl. Pour in vodka and toss to coat. Cover with plastic wrap and let chill in the refrigerator until serving.

SPIKED WATERMELON SALAD RECIPE | EPICURIOUS
Use red or yellow watermelon (or both) for this summery dessert, and pair it with the best store-bought brownies you can find.

- Place watermelon in large bowl. Whisk fresh lemon juice and sugar in medium bowl until sugar dissolves. Whisk in vodka and crème de cassis. Season mixture to taste with salt. Pour mixture over watermelon. Cover and chill at least 1 hour and up to 2 hours. Sprinkle with chopped fresh mint and serve.

HOW TO MAKE VODKA SOAKED STRAWBERRIES: 8 STEPS (WITH PICTURES)
Mar 04, 2021 · Sterilize a quart-size jar by running the jar through the dishwasher or by soaking it in boiling water. Place the strawberries inside the jar. Pour the cup of vodka over the berries. Save the vodka bottle and lid if you want to use the strawberry-infused vodka later on. Refrigerate the jarred fruit for 1 to 24 hours.

LIQUORED UP WATERMELON FRUIT BOWL - RECIPE GIRL
Jun 30, 2018 · Boil sugar and water together until sugar dissolves. Remove from heat and let cool for a bit. Add the vodka, rum, lime juice and lime zest and stir to combine. Cool. Scoop out round balls of cantaloupe, honeydew and seedless watermelon (or cut into chunks). Place inside a hollowed out watermelon or watermelon basket.
